Write a Python program to extract a given number of randomly selected elements from a given list. Python Strings Slicing Strings Modify Strings Concatenate Strings Format Strings Escape Characters String Methods String Exercises. We can do slicing by providing two indices separated by a colon. It has a great package ecosystem, there's much less noise than you'll find in other languages, and it is super easy to use. code, Method #2 : Using join() + isnumeric() + list comprehension + map(). How to extract numbers from a string in Python? While using python for data manipulation, we may come across lists whose elements are a mix of letters and numbers with a fixed pattern. List indexing. Sometimes, we can data in many forms and we desire to perform both conversions and extractions of certain specific parts of a whole. This program emphasizes on how to extract numbers from a string in python. Sample Solution: Python Code: import random def random_select_nums(n_list, n): return random.sample(n_list, n) n_list = [1,1,2,3,4,4,5,1] print("Original list:") print(n_list) selec_nums = 3 result = random_select_nums(n_list, selec_nums) print("\nSelected 3 random numbers of the above list:") print(result… I have an 8000-element 1D array. Slicing means accessing a range of list. Check each element of the given list. Python Server Side Programming Programming If you only want positive integers, you can split and search for numbers as follows: >>> str = "h3110 23 cat 444.4 rabbit 11 2 dog" >>> [int(s) for s in str.split() if s.isdigit()] [23, 11, 2] generate link and share the link here. from a string.. We need to import the regex library into the python environment before … Since the list has zero as the first index, so a list of size ten will have indices from 0 to 9. Method #1 : Using list comprehension + split(). The first value is the start index and the second value is the to index. In this approach we go through each element and check for the numeric part present in each element. asked Jul 12, 2019 in Python by Sammy (47.8k points) I would extract all the numbers contained in a string. This method is preferred in the instances in which it is not predefined that the numbers will be ordered in a particular way i.e, this method gives the flexibility of getting the number from whichever position possible. To get the list of all numbers in a String, use the regular expression ‘[0-9]+’ with re.findall() method. Even number produces zero balance when the number is divided by two. [0-9] represents a regular expression to match a single digit in the string. The result will be showed as 0 when there are no numbers in the string. Index operator. While programming, you may face many scenarios where list to string conversion is required. It is important to note that python is a zero indexed based language. It can also contain duplicates. Extract numbers from list of strings in Python Python Server Side Programming Programming While using python for data manipulation, we may come across lists whose elements are a mix of letters and numbers with a fixed pattern. The list can contain any of the following object types: Strings, Characters, Numbers. Each item i n a list has an assigned index value. In this tutorial, we are going to discuss how to find odd and even numbers from a list in the Python program. Python Data Types Python Numbers Python Casting Python Strings. Sometimes it really becomes important for us to get the first specific number of items from a list in Python. list index() parameters. Program to find longest common prefix from list of strings in Python, Convert list of strings and characters to list of characters in Python. 24', 'Rs. 0 votes . If the element in the list starts with S, I want '-' to be inserted before the integer. Sometimes, we can data in many forms and we desire to perform both conversions and extractions of certain specific parts of a whole. The list index() method can take a maximum of three arguments:. The main aim here is achieved by splitting the string and inserting into a list, Traversal of this list and then further using the isdigit() function( Returns boolean if there is a number) to confirm if the value is a number… Take the input in the form of a list. Use List Comprehension to Extract Numbers From a String Numbers from a string can be obtained by simple list comprehension. How to extract numbers from a string using Python? traceback.format_list (extracted_list) ¶ Given a list of tuples or FrameSummary objects as returned by extract_tb() or extract_stack(), return a list of strings ready for printing. How to Convert Python List to String (5 replies) Hello I am trying to grab some numbers from a string containing HTML text. To get items or elements from the Python list, you can use list index number. The index numbers help us retrieve individual elements from a list. close, link Original numbers in the list: [34, 1, 0, -23] Positive numbers in the list: [34, 1] Flowchart: Visualize Python code execution: The following tool visualize what the computer is doing step-by-step as it executes the said program: edit How to extract numbers from text using Python regular expression? Which is better suited for the purpose, regular expressions or the isdigit() method? In this article we will see how to separate the numbers form letters which can be used for future calculations. The original list : ['Rs. This program emphasizes on how to extract numbers from a string in python. To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course. Questions: I would extract all the numbers contained in a string. If the element in the list starts with S, I want '-' to be inserted before the integer. In Python, use list methods clear(), pop(), and remove() to remove items (elements) from a list. numbers … Python is used for a number of things, from data analysis to server programming. Which is the better suited for the purpose, regular expressions or the isdigit() method? How to get column names in Pandas dataframe, Reading and Writing to text files in Python, Python | Split string into list of characters, Python program to check whether a number is Prime or not, Write Interview Example: line = "hello 12 hi 89" Result: [12, 89] But if … To quickly find the index of a list element, identify its position number in the list, and then subtract 1. Extracting EVEN and ODD numbers from the list: Here, we are going to learn how to extract Even and odd number from a given list in Python programming language? Python program to find odd and even number from list. This means we only extracted the phone number without spaces and country code. For this list, if the element in the list starts with N, i want '+' to be inserted before the integer. Index of the list in Python: Index means the position of something. Attention geek! A5 stands the first data you want to extract numbers only from the list. Remember that Python lists index always starts from 0. The main aim here is achieved by splitting the string and inserting into a list, Traversal of this list and then further using the isdigit() function( Returns boolean if there is a number) to confirm if the value is a number… Extracting Data from Specific Cells. [0-9] represents a regular expression to match a single digit in the string. A Python function to extract structured elements from text lists, and get basic statistics about them. numbers = re.findall(' [0-9]+'… How to extract strings based on first character from a vector of strings in R? The previous example is helpful, perhaps, when looking at a list of headings for a worksheet over a remote connection. Python regular expressions library called ‘regex library‘ enables us to detect the presence of particular characters such as digits, some special characters, etc. In this guide, we'll discuss some simple ways to extract text from a file using the Python 3 programming language. We’ve listed a few here. Algorithm to extract even and odd number from the given list. Get first N items from a list in Python. Example: line = "hello 12 hi 89" Result: [12, 89] Answers: If you only want to extract only positive integers, … Let’s discuss certain ways in which this can be solved. Index of the list in Python: Index means the position of something. Python extract number from array python extract elements from array, Based on your example, a simple workaround would be this: train = [X [i] for i, _ in enumerate (X) if i not in idx]. Odd number produces one as balance when the number is divided by two. matches.append (phone_num) The program has now the list of phone numbers in the format “9559595595”. Running the above code gives us the following result − # Define a list heterogenousElements = [3, True, 'Michael', 2.0] The list contains an int, a bool, a string, and a float. Extracting Data from Specific Cells. acknowledge that you have read and understood our, GATE CS Original Papers and Official Keys, ISRO CS Original Papers and Official Keys, ISRO CS Syllabus for Scientist/Engineer Exam, Python | Extract digits from given string, Python program to find number of days between two given dates, Python | Difference between two dates (in minutes) using datetime.timedelta() method, Python | Convert string to DateTime and vice-versa, Convert the column type from string to datetime format in Pandas dataframe, Adding new column to existing DataFrame in Pandas, Create a new column in Pandas DataFrame based on the existing columns, Python | Creating a Pandas dataframe column based on a given condition, Selecting rows in pandas DataFrame based on conditions, Get all rows in a Pandas DataFrame containing given substring, Python | Find position of a character in given string, replace() in Python to replace a substring, Python | Replace substring in list of strings, Python – Replace Substrings from String List, Python program to convert a list to string. The integer empty lists to store the even and odd number which will be extracted from the Python programming Course! Structured Strings in Python: index means the position of something of list is at... And emoji are some of the lists from the list starts with S, I '-! Number is divided by two since the list in Python now see how to get items elements. Us the following result − the following code digit sequences of any length the unique values from string... The number is divided by two scenarios where list to string Python data Types Python numbers Python Casting Python slicing... Only extracted the phone number without spaces and country code use list index number ways which! In the program below the list starts with S, I want '- ' to inserted! In a JavaScript array to remove Duplicates from a list element, identify its position number the... To get all unique values from a string in Python: index the. Please use ide.geeksforgeeks.org, generate link and share the link here number which be... Indices from 0 the string let ’ S now see how can we use index. From it using the Python DS Course of any length check for the part. It really becomes important for us to get all unique values from a list in Python in it the of... ’ S now see how to Convert Python list Slice a list first with some in. List indexing find number of things, from data analysis to server programming by (! Or elements from the above-created list by using the Python list list indexing data in many forms and desire... For this list, if the element you ’ ll find many ways accessing. A code snippet to help you out represents a regular expression + represents continuous digit sequences of any length trying. Some simple ways to extract if the element in the string extract number from list python extract... ( remove Duplicates ) in a string using Python through each element and check for purpose. To quickly find the index numbers help us retrieve individual elements from the Python list, then! Remove Duplicates from a list use ide.geeksforgeeks.org, generate link and share the link here start index and the value... To give you a better understand, I want to extract numbers from a list the isdigit ( and... The unique values from a string in Python: index means the position of something any functions. A for loop to capture each, Running the above code gives us the following −. Assigned index value now the list, if the element of accessing or indexing the elements of list... Index, so a list of numbers in the Python programming Foundation Course and learn the basics with! Your interview preparations Enhance your data Structures concepts with the same function repeatedly each! Specific parts of a list of headings for a number of items from string... That along with a for loop to capture each, Running the above code gives us following! By providing two indices separated by a colon then I will create a list capture each, Running above... Do this even and odd number which will be extracted from the list. Be showed as 0 when there are no numbers in the string a maximum of three:... N items from a list of Strings in Python by Sammy ( points. By Bipin Kumar, on November 11, 2019 where list to string data. Want to extract numbers only from the Python 3 programming language Strings in?... Resulting list corresponds to the item with the Python list list indexing ) hello I am trying to some... Sometimes it really becomes important for us to get items or elements from the Python list. Python is used for future calculations showed as 0 when there are no numbers in the Python list... Accessing or indexing the elements of a list first with some elements in it S! Each extract number from list python Running the above code gives us the following code based first., you can use list index number to index is exclusive please use ide.geeksforgeeks.org, generate link and the. The given list first specific number of things, from data analysis to server programming #. To one of the available entities to extract even and odd number from the Python Course! A better understand, I will create a list on first character from a string in the list zero. Index, so a list in the string algorithm to extract only the unique values from a using... Has an assigned index value how to get all unique values from a string by help of Python. Get all unique values ( remove Duplicates from a string containing HTML text code snippet to you... I am here to provide a code snippet to help you out phone numbers in the string first N from... Subtract 1 number, then add this to one of the list Python! With, your interview preparations Enhance your data Structures concepts with the programming. Ways in which this can be solved in R to the item with the same in. To extract required data from structured Strings in Python: index means the position of something even and number. An even number, then add this to one of the list index ( and. Us retrieve individual elements from the above-created list by using extract number from list python append method 2019. List to string Python data Types Python numbers Python Casting Python Strings this can be.... “ Automate the boring stuff with Python ” called phone number and Email Address Extractor even! While programming, you can use list index ( ) method is an even number, add. '+ ' to be inserted before the integer from text using Python regular expression to match a single in... To one of the lists from the given list so I am here to provide a code snippet to you... Quickly find the index operator ( [ ] ) to access an element the! Learn the basics the previous example is helpful, perhaps, when looking at list... Index value how to extract even and odd number from the list size... And text has zero as the first value is the better suited for the purpose, regular or! To server programming 89 ] list index ( ) method have hyphen as separator... Of the lists from the Python DS Course knowing the number of arithmetic subsequences a! Let ’ S now see how to get items or elements from the given.. Based on first character from a string in Python Jul 12, 2019 Python: index means position! Numbers in the string Automate the boring stuff with Python ” called phone number and Address... Jul 12, 2019 in Python which this can be solved to Convert Python list, the. Data in many forms and we desire to perform both conversions and extractions of certain specific parts of a.! `` hello 12 hi 89 '' result: [ 12, 2019 the map is... You suggest any extract number from list python functions that I could use to do this list to string conversion is.!: index means the position of something we can do slicing by providing two indices separated a... Python is a zero indexed based language the start index and the value. Am here to provide a code snippet to help you out index operator ( [ ] ) access... Methods string Exercises numbers from a string in Python the first index, so a.... Empty Strings from a string in the string you ’ ll find many ways of accessing or indexing elements... Html text Strings Modify Strings Concatenate Strings format Strings Escape Characters string Methods string Exercises extracted phone. The first item of list is indexed at 0 remote connection when are! The resulting list corresponds to the item with the Python DS Course and! This means we only extracted the phone number and Email Address Extractor and check extract number from list python! Values ( remove Duplicates from a list index means the position of something means. Extracted the phone number without spaces and country code generate link and share the link here as! Desire to perform both conversions and extractions of certain specific parts of a whole or indexing the elements a... Unique values ( remove Duplicates from a file using the getPage ( ) method with. To match extract number from list python single digit in the form of a Python list, you can use list (. When there are no numbers in extract number from list python format “ 9559595595 ” Python called. Us the following result − index is inclusive and to index is exclusive form letters which can be.. The pages, you may face many scenarios where list to string conversion is.. From structured Strings in Python ll find many ways of accessing or indexing the elements of character... Index always starts from 0 to 9 the argument list Escape Characters string Methods string Exercises divided. Of three arguments: get first N items from a list in Python ll find many of. Result will be showed as 0 when there are no numbers in Python the start index and the second is... Has now the list in Python want to extract numbers from a in! It really becomes important for us to get items or elements from a list, the first specific number the! Program emphasizes on how to extract we only extracted the phone number without and! Provide a code snippet to help you out analysis to server programming when there are no numbers the! An element from the given list treated as a separator this article we will use the join ( method...